TeamDesk online database software empowers you with a quick and efficient database creation tool. It allows to build unique databases from scratch and customize each database to fit your specific business needs. As a result, you can store and organize daily work information in an easily accessible data source for your team.

TeamDesk customers are businesses of all sizes that are located all over the world. Large companies, small businesses and nonprofits can build online databases according to their unique structure and business needs.

TeamDesk provides an unlimited data storage, unlimited support and allows an unlimited database complexity for no extra costs.

TOP best Microsoft Access replacement software for databases
LibreOffice Base has a host of handy features, including cross-database support for multi-user databases such as MySQL, Adabas D, Microsoft Access, and PostgreSQL. LibreOffice Base is probably an almost direct copy of Microsoft Access. Both are front-end database management tools.
